What is the free childcare expansion?

The free childcare expansion refers to policies implemented by various governments to provide either fully subsidized or reduced-cost childcare services. This aims to make early education more accessible for all families, particularly low-income households.

How to access free childcare services

Accessing free childcare services can greatly benefit families looking for support. Understanding the steps to access these services is essential for parents seeking assistance.

Eligibility Criteria

First, it’s important to know the eligibility criteria for free childcare programs. Most programs consider several factors, including family income, the number of children, and the children’s ages. By checking local government websites, families can find specific information regarding the requirements in their area.

Application Process

Once eligibility is determined, families can start the application process. Applications can often be completed online, at community centers, or through local government offices. Parents should prepare documents such as proof of income, identification, and birth certificates.

It’s also a good idea for parents to reach out to local childcare providers to inquire about vacancies and specific services offered. Many providers will have a waiting list and can provide guidance on securing a spot.

Utilizing Community Resources

Community resources play a crucial role in accessing these services. Local non-profits and family support organizations often have staff available to help families navigate the application process. They can offer vital information on nearby facilities and the types of programs available.

Networking with other parents can also yield helpful insights. Joining local parent groups or online forums can connect families with similar needs, allowing them to share experiences and tips on accessing free childcare services.
